SUBJECT: TRADITIONAL TURKISH TROOP BUILD-UP UNDERWAY FOR
EXPECTED PKK SPRING OFFENSIVE
Classified By: CDA Nancy McEldowney, reasons 1.4 (b) and (d).
1. (C) On the eve of the March 21 Newroz celebrations in
honor of the Kurdish New Year, the Turkish press reported a
significant troop build-up along Turkey's border with Iraq in
preparation for the traditional spring offensive by the PKK
terrorist organization in southeast Turkey. Land Forces
Commander GEN Basbug reportedly made a public plea on March
13 for a peaceful New Year's celebration but also took the
opportunity to rattle the TGS saber and reiterate Turkey's
right under international law to conduct a cross-border
operation (CBO) into Iraq against the PKK. According to the
press, TGS dispatched additional troops, including commando
units, to the border provinces with Iraq to prevent PKK
infiltration, as it has traditionally done in the spring.
Independent sources have confirmed that these movements
appear consistent with past years.
2. (SBU) The holiday passed in relative quiet, but just days
later three Turkish soldiers were killed and two wounded by a
land mine during a clash with up to 20 PKK elements, in what
the press characterized as one of the first operations in the
annual spring offensive against the rebels. Low-level
clashes occurred throughout the winter as TGS conducted
operations against PKK elements holed-up in southeast Turkey
but the mild winter has meant an early melting of the snows
and increased maneuverability for the terrorists in the
mountainous border terrain, leading to expectations of an
early increase in PKK violence in Turkey.
